WebMar 13, 2024 · Cotton is a seed-hair fiber made mostly of cellulose. The fibers are composed of about 87 to 90 percent cellulose (a carbohydrate plant substance), 5 to 8 percent water, and 4 to 6 percent natural impurities. Rayon is a man-made fabric, a semi-synthetic cellulosic fiber.

WebSome manmade fibers are cellulose-based. Rayon raw cellulose, for example, is sourced from cotton, wood pulp, various grasses, and bamboo.
